  5. William Oliver Swofford (February 22, 1945 – February 12, 2000), known professionally as Oliver, was an American pop singer. Born in North Wilkesboro , North Carolina , he began singing as an undergraduate at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ill in the early 1960s.

  6. 16 lut 2000 · SHREVEPORT, La. -- William Oliver Swofford, a singer who under the stage name Oliver had late-'60s hits with the songs "Good Morning, Starshine" and "Jean," has died at 54.
